A Prep period is a period where no class is being taken, for both students and teachers. It generally does not refer to zero period and period 8 when they are not being taken.

Obtaining a prep =

There are 3 ways to obtain a prep:

Taking classes outside the 1-7 range

By registering for a course during zero period or period 8, a prep is automatically placed during periods 1-7 for the duration of that course. Additionally, each semester in Kickstarter results in a single-semester prep during the following school year.

Athletics

Students who participate in athletics do not need to attend PE, provided that they fill out the proper forms. This is not a full prep, as they must return to PE the day after their final game.

Signing up for the "Prep" course

Students may also take fewer than 7 classes by explicitly requesting the course called "Prep." Each grade has its own minimum number of classes.
